Player Bio
Akshita Suryaprakash Maheshwari is a right-handed batter and a right-arm medium-pace bowler. She was born on October 10, 2000, in Jaipur, Rajasthan. She represents Mumbai Indians (MI) in the Women's Premier League (WPL) 2025 season and the Rajasthan Women’s team at the domestic level. 

As a youngster, Maheshwari was a lively kid who loved sports. Playing cricket with children in the neighbourhood, she began her cricketing career and ended up breaking countless windows. Her parents persisted in supporting her and urged her to follow her passion despite social conventions.

A significant moment came in her life when she visited the KL Saini Stadium with her brother and saw girls playing cricket. Soon after, she enrolled at the academy, where Vishal Tiwari coached her.


"Even the first ball I bowled there fell exactly on the good length as it's supposed to," the coach had said in a contemplative interview.  


She took 23 wickets in the Under-23 Women's One Trophy, making her the competition's second-highest wicket-taker. Two hat-tricks against Mizoram and Odisha, both in Mumbai, were part of her incredible accomplishment.


Maheshwari started grabbing opportunities, and soon, her name was called up in the 2025 WPL auction. Mumbai Indians included her in the squad for INR 20 lakh. She didn’t just mark a milestone in her career but also became the first-ever female cricketer from Rajasthan to join WPL.


Off the field, she acknowledges that a major factor in her success has been her family's unwavering support. Her ability to multitask is demonstrated by her current pursuit of a Bachelor of Education (B.Ed.) degree from Chandigarh.


Although she wants to give the team her all, her ultimate objective is to represent India and play at the highest level.


(As of February 2025)
